TDHS Riverhawks Make Some Noise Ahead of Tonight's Homecoming Game

The Dalles, Ore., October 6, 2023 – The Dalles High School is celebrating Homecoming this week, today students, teachers, and coaches took to the streets as a part of the noise parade tradition. 

“To be downtown with them today, it felt so good. I thought, finally these kids are getting to experience what High School is all about. Seeing the excitement and feeling the support of the community, I almost teared up,” said Paul Erickson, Teacher at TDHS. 

Students will get to enjoy a shortened class schedule today in order to participate in fun activities such as a pep assembly, field fun, a color war, and the election of the homecoming court before tonight's homecoming football game.

The TDHS Riverhawks will face off against Mollala at Wahtonka Field at 6 p.m. Senior Night Kick-Off festivities, including the presentation of the Homecoming Court will begin prior to the kick-off at 5:30 p.m. 

Win or lose on Friday night, students will still have the homecoming dance at The Dalles Middle School to look forward to on Saturday.
